Cambodians have settled across much of the United States. However high concentrations can be found in Long Beach CA, Lowell MA, Lynn MA, Stockton CA, Providence RI, New York City (Bronx) Fresno CA, Fall River MA, and Greensboro NC. These cities have at least 5,000 Cambodians and upwards of 35,000 to 50,000 in Lowell and Long Beach respectively.
